Best WordPress Security Plugins Compared

Disclosure: Our content is reader-supported, which means we earn commissions from links on Crazy Egg. Commissions do not affect our editorial evaluations or opinions.

Disclosure: This content is reader-supported, which means if you click on some of our links that we may earn a commission.

Security plugins are essential for any website because they scan, protect, and remove malware that may infiltrate your site. WordPress offers over 900 security plugins, and after reviewing dozens of them, we determined that Sucuri is the best option for most users. Sucuri is an extensive all-in-one security plugin that offers advanced, brute force protection for any WordPress website while remaining remarkably user-friendly for inexperienced site owners. 

The Best WordPress Security Plugin for Most

Sucuri Logo


Best for Most

Sucuri’s all-in-one security platform not only has one of the best firewalls on the market, but also includes malware removal--unlike most other WP security plugins. The best part? You get all that on the free basic plan.

Sucuri is an industry leader in WordPress security, making it an excellent option for most WordPress users because of its versatility and beginner-friendly interface. 

Sucuri has one of the best firewall filters on the market, and is responsible for cleaning up over 700 websites a day. Big-name brands like Crossfit, Miami University, and NYU trust Sucuri—making it a great security solution for small and enterprise-level businesses alike. 

The best part is that Sucuri is affordable, with a free subscription available to all users, where you get access to the basic—but still valuable—features of its security service. 

The Best WordPress Security Plugin Options to Consider 

  1. Sucuri – Best for most 
  2. Wordfence – Best for multiple sites 
  3. Jetpack – Best for downtime monitoring
  4. iThemes Security Pro – Best for two-factor authentication
  5. All-in-One WP Security and Firewall– Best free-forever plugin

When It Makes Sense to Invest Into WordPress Security Plugins 

Anyone who owns a website to run their business, WordPress or not, would benefit from a security plugin. So the most obvious time to invest in a WordPress security plugin is the same day you start your website, so you’re protected from the very beginning.  

Generally, larger businesses with more successful websites are more prone to malicious attacks, so if your website is becoming more popular, we might recommend investing in a more robust security plugin (or at least making sure the one you have is up-to-date and fully functional). 

Finally, if you’ve been the victim of a cyber attack or even accidentally had some malware infect your site, you absolutely want to invest in a new security plugin immediately–especially if you either didn’t have one before or the one you had didn’t protect you the way it promised. 

It’s never too early to install security, even if you opt for a free version. Now, let’s look at some of the security options you would greatly benefit from as a WordPress user.

#1 – Sucuri – The Best WordPress Security Plugin for Most

Sucuri Logo


Best for Most

Sucuri’s all-in-one security platform not only has one of the best firewalls on the market, but also includes malware removal--unlike most other WP security plugins. The best part? You get all that on the free basic plan.

As mentioned above, Sucuri is the best WordPress security plugin for most users. With its strong focus on cleaning and protecting websites, you will definitely be in safe hands when working with its cloud-based software. 

Apart from Sucuri’s ability to protect your website from malicious attacks, its best feature by far is its malware removal. Security plugins always focus on protection, but what if your website does become infiltrated? Luckily, Sucuri is well-equipped to handle this. 

Sucuri offers free malware removal to all users. And with the free version of the plugin, you get access to features like post-hack, Sucuri firewall integration, malware scanning, core integrity check, and email alerts. 

You’ll get even more anti-malware features in its paid subscriptions, which you can easily integrate into your WordPress site. With malware removal on a paid plan, you receive a dedicated incident response team and state-of-the-art technology, so your website will be up and running before any attacks damage your reputation. 

Not only does Sucuri remove malware and restore your website completely, but it also removes blocklist status, repairs SEO spam, and prevents future attacks with its WAF firewall. 

Sucuri uses machine learning, application profiling, virtual patching, and WordPress hardening to protect your website against malicious attacks. With its advanced security tools, it also monitors and detects attacks before they have even begun. 

Sucuri offers an extensive suite of security features that are crucial to protecting your site. Some of these features include: 

  • DNS and uptime monitoring 
  • Brute force attacks protection 
  • DDoS attack mitigation 
  • Zero-day exploit prevention
  • CDN performance and speed optimization 

The Sucuri security plugin is available to download and install for free on any WordPress website running version 3.6 or higher. However, if you want access to more of the advanced features we discussed above, you will need to pay the price. 

  • Basic: $199.99 per site, per year 
  • Pro: $299.99 per site, per year 
  • Business: $499.99 per site, per year 
  • Custom Solutions: You can call the Sucuri sales team to discuss multiple site pricing, seamless integration, and emergency response SLAs. 

Sucuri offers a 30-day money-back guarantee on all plans.

#2 – Wordfence – The Best WordPress Security Plugin for Multiple Sites 

Wordfence Logo


Best for Multiple Sites

Want to protect more than just one site, with no extra installations? Wordfence helps you cover all your WordPress sites in one plugin with one centralized security center.

Wordfence is an endpoint firewall-based security plugin that is popular among WordPress users. With over 150 million downloads worldwide, Wordfence is a trusted option to secure multiple sites. 

Wordfence has the best threat intelligence in the industry because it uses a “threat defense feed,” which has the newest firewall rules, malware signatures, and malicious IP addresses to keep your website safe. Free users will receive the community version of this feed, but unfortunately, it takes 30 days to gain access to. 

Wordfence also offers what’s known as Wordfence Central, which is one of the most important features on its platform, as it allows you to manage and monitor security for multiple sites within the same plugin–no additional installation necessary. 

The Wordfence Central hub is free to use. However, you must purchase multiple site licenses to run security on multiple WordPress sites—which we will get into a little later on. 

With Wordfence Central, you get access to a customizable dashboard, security findings, and configuration, all within one platform. 

Not only does Wordfence do an incredible job at letting you manage and host security on multiple sites, but it offers powerful features that keep those websites safe. Some of the best features include: 

  • Repair files 
  • Leaked password protection 
  • Advanced manual blocking 
  • Country blocking 
  • Live traffic 

For free users, you get access to the WordPress firewall and security scanner, both of which scan for malware and protect against attacks. The endpoint firewall doesn’t break encryption or leak data, as hackers can’t bypass it. 

Wordfence is a free security plugin that you can integrate with your WordPress websites. However, to receive real-time security scans and access to multiple site management, you will need to upgrade to Wordfence Premium. 

You can purchase up to 15 Wordfence licenses and save up to 25% when you buy more. All site licenses come with premium support and reputation checks. 

  • 1 license: $99 
  • 2-4 licenses: $89.10 with 10% off 
  • 5-9 licenses: $84.15 with 15% off 
  • 10-14 licenses: $79.20 with 20% off 
  • 15+ licenses: $74.25 with 25% off 

You must purchase Wordfence Premium on an annual license. But you can choose to purchase on a two or three-year contract and get an extra 20-30% off. 

Wordfence offers a 30-day money-back guarantee on all licenses. 

#3 – Jetpack – The Best WordPress Security Plugin for Downtime Monitoring

Jetpack Logo


Best for Downtime Monitoring

Downtime is the worst! Make sure your site gets back up as soon as possible with Jetpack. And don’t worry about extra installs, because Jetpack is already loaded into your WP site!

The free version of Jetpack is one of the few integrations that automatically comes with all WordPress subscriptions. With its premium version being a more comprehensive and easy-to-use plugin that offers advanced security measures and backups. 

Many WordPress users are probably already familiar with Jetpack, as WordPress offers you the essential features on their paid plans, like site performance, protection from spammers, detailed activity records, improved SEO, and social media sharing. 

However, the premium version of the Jetpack security features are much more beneficial and will help you protect your website efficiently. One of these features is downtime monitoring, which Jetpack does brilliantly. 

The Jetpack downtime monitor will continuously watch your site and alert you immediately via email and/or the Jetpack mobile app when it detects any downtime. Once you activate the downtime monitor, one of Jetpack’s servers will start monitoring your website every five minutes until it finds the issue. 

Jetpack also specializes in security scans with automated malware scanning and one-click fixes. You can review the WordPress scanning log in one centralized place, where you get to fix problems and restore backups. 

You will benefit from some other standard security features like: 

  • Brute force attack protection 
  • Secure authentication
  • Anti-spam 
  • 24/7 support 
  • Unlimited site storage 

You can get Jetpack for free, but you will need to purchase a Jetpack Premium plan for advanced features. 

  • Backup Daily: $7.50 per month, billed at $90 per year 
  • Security Daily: $17.45 per month, billed at $209.40 per year 
  • Complete: $69.90 per month, billed at $838.80 per year 

For large to enterprise-level businesses, Jetpack offers other packages for real-time security. 

  • Security Real-time: $50 per month, billed at $600 per year 
  • Backup Real-time: $37.50 per month, billed at $450 per year 
  • Scan: $7.50 per month, billed at $90 per year 

Jetpack offers a 14-day money-back guarantee

#4 – iThemes Security Pro – The Best WordPress Security Plugin for Two-Factor Authentication

iThemes Logo

iThemes Security Pro

Best for Two-Factor Authentication

When you’re away from your computer, two-factor authentication makes sure you’re alerted when anyone else tries to access it--and can stop them from wherever you are. For that extra security, iThemes Security Pro is your best bet.

iThemes Security Pro is a trusted plugin that was built by WordPress security experts. It has an extensive focus on the two-factor authentication feature, making it an excellent choice for added security measures for your user account. 

iThemes Security Pro offers a one-click install via the WordPress plugins dashboard, and with an intuitive interface and layout, you can start protecting your website in minutes. 

Most security plugins will offer a two-factor authentication feature, but iThemes Security Pro goes the extra mile for its users by offering security codes and backup codes via mobile app and email. The iThemes Security Pro two-factor authentication stands out because it’s compatible with all time-based one-time provider (TOTP) apps. 

Any two-factor authentication app that supports TOTP will seamlessly integrate with the iThemes Security Pro platform. The most popular apps for both Android and iOS devices include Google Authenticator, Authy, FreeOTP Authenticator, and Troopher. 

Not only will you receive a second code to your email or mobile device after entering your password, but iThemes Security Pro lets you request backup codes if the primary two-factor method is lost or expired. 

Two-factor authentication isn’t the only significant feature that iThemes Security Pro offers its users. Some other robust features include: 

  • File change detection 
  • Lockout bad users 
  • Hide login and admin 
  • Database backups 
  • Away mode 

With the free version of iThemes Security Pro, you get 30+ powerful features from malware scanning and security logs to network brute force protection and reduce comment spam. However, if you want more advanced real-time security features and automatic updates, you will need to purchase an upgraded plan. 

All iThemes Security Pro plans come with one year of ticketed support and one year of plugin updates. 

  • Blogger: $80 per year for one site
  • Small Business: $127 per year for 10 sites
  • Gold: $199 per year for unlimited sites

iThemes Security Pro offers a 30-day money-back guarantee

#5 – All-in-One WP Security and Firewall – Best Free-Forever WordPress Security Plugin 

All-in-One Logo

All-in-One WP Security and Firewall

Best Free-Forever Security Plugin

Security can be complicated and expensive. Why not try a basic plugin designed to help beginners get straightforward security for free? That’s exactly what All-in-One WP offers.

The All-in-One WP Security and Firewall plugin is one of the more basic security platforms. It is also one of the few free-forever security plugins, which can be a great option for beginners wanting to learn the ropes of a security system. 

Despite the All-in-One WP Security and Firewall plugin being completely free, it’s still quite comprehensive and well-supported by WordPress. It helps to reduce security risk by automatically checking for vulnerabilities and enforcing the latest WordPress security practices. 

The great thing about All-in-One WP Security and Firewall is that it categorizes its security and firewall rules into three classifications of “basic,” “intermediate,” and “advanced.” This classification system makes sure you can apply the firewall progressively without breaking any functionalities within your website. 

All-in-One WP Security and Firewall offers an extensive suite of features that will protect your website, from user accounts security to database security. It also works with the most popular WordPress plugins, so you don’t need to worry about the security system slowing down your website. 

Some of All-in-One WP Security and Firewall best features include: 

  • Ability to lock down the front end of your site 
  • Ban users by specifying IP addresses or user agents 
  • Backup and modify files 
  • Easily view and monitor all host system logs 
  • Ability to add Google reCaptcha 

The All-in-One WP Security and Firewall plugin is 100% free forever and offers 24/7 support through its support forums.

Methodology for Choosing the Best WordPress Security Plugin

There are a few factors that go into finding the best WordPress security plugin for your website needs. Sometimes it’s difficult to choose the right plugin when you don’t know what elements to look for. So we put together this methodology of the three most important elements that make up a good WordPress security plugin. 

Malware Removal

Malware removal is one of the most important elements of any security plugin. Malware removal ensures that the software you are paying for can quickly and effectively clear your website if it was ever maliciously infiltrated. 

Not every security plugin offers this service, as many of them simply protect and scan your website—and if they do—you may have to pay an additional cost. However, Sucuri is an excellent choice when it comes to malware removal. 

With Sucuri, you don’t need to pay any extra costs as they clean your site for free. You can even use Sucuri to remove malware from your website without being an existing customer. All you need to do is pick a plan, set up an account, and request malware removal. 

Security Alerts 

A security plugin should offer security alerts and notifications. However, it’s to which device that matters most. Many plugins will send alerts to an email account, which is great—but not everyone has access to their email all the time. 

Some people don’t have their email signed in on their phone (you should!), or they simply don’t have access to their computer 24/7. Luckily, iThemes Security Pro and Jetpack are great at sending alerts to both a mobile app and email. 

When you look for a security plugin, look for something that sends alerts to multiple devices for increased safety. 

Ease of Use

Normally we wouldn’t make such a broad category a major deciding factor, but let’s face it,  security software can be confusing, time-consuming, and overwhelming for some people. So it’s important to find a plugin that offers an easy setup and intuitive interface. 

Every plugin we recommend here is easy to use, but especially Wordfence and All-in-One WP Security and Firewall. Both plugins offer either customizable platforms or categorized menus for easy navigation. 

Sucuri Logo


Best for Most

Sucuri’s all-in-one security platform not only has one of the best firewalls on the market, but also includes malware removal--unlike most other WP security plugins. The best part? You get all that on the free basic plan.


Overall, Sucuri is our top recommendation as to the best WordPress security plugin on the market. 

It’s free software, but its paid plans are still affordable for their value. Sucuri supports users by offering free malware removal and website restoration, brute force attack protection, and prevents future attacks—making it an excellent choice for most users. 

With that said, Wordfence is a close second because of its ability to host and protect multiple sites at a discounted price. All options on our list are excellent for different reasons, and by following our methodology, you’ll find the right plugin for you. 

Make your website better. Instantly.

Over 300,000 websites use Crazy Egg to improve what's working, fix what isn't and test new ideas.

Free 30-day Trial